Embodiment 1

[0027] as attached Figure 4As shown, the main equipment of the 1Mw wood powder and bamboo powder fluidized bed gasification-internal combustion engine power generation co-produced material charcoal project is as follows: gasification reactor, subdivided separator, biomass fluidized bed gasification combustible gas automatic separation of tar Thermal cracking unit, heat exchanger 1, heat exchanger 2, dust collector, fan, internal combustion engine, etc. The 600-700°C combustible gas (calorific value is about 1200kcal) produced by the fluidized bed gasification reactor first passes through the subdivision separator to separate the biomass char, and then enters the biomass fluidized bed gasification for self-heating of the tar in the combustible gas Cracking device, the burner in the cracker is ignited first, and the heat storage body of the cracker is heated by combustible gas combustion. Abstract

The invention relates to self-heat-supply cracking device for tar in biomass fluidized bed gasification combustible gas. The self-heat-supply cracking device comprises a fuel gas inlet pipe, a cracking cavity, a gas distribution pipe, a heat accumulator, a combustor, a controller, three electric valves, a fuel gas outlet pipe and two thermocouples. The heat accumulator, the combustor, the controller, two of the electric valves and one of the thermocouple form a control system to control the temperature of the heat accumulator; the gas distribution pipe, the controller, the other thermocouple and the other electric valve form a control system to control the temperature of the cracking cavity. The self-heat-supply cracking device has advantages that 1) by combustion of self-produced combustible gas, the temperature of the heat accumulator is kept above 900 DEG C to provide a combustion high-temperature environment for combustion of the combustible gas; 2) by control uniform air sprayingquantity of an air distribution device, combustible gas combustion quantity is controlled, the cracking cavity is further controlled to be 850 DEG C above, and cracking of the tar in the combustible gas is guaranteed; 3) external heat sources are avoided, and simple structure and effectiveness in economic cost reduction are realized.

Description

technical field [0001] The invention relates to a self-heating cracking device for gasifying tar in combustible gas in a biomass fluidized bed, which belongs to the field of biomass energy. Background technique [0002] Under the dual pressure of energy and the environment, vigorously developing clean and renewable energy has become a very urgent worldwide issue before governments all over the world. Compared with other new energy sources, biomass energy has the characteristics of being renewable, less polluting, transportable and storing, and most compatible with the current energy industry, so it has attracted special attention. China is a large agricultural country with rich agricultural and forestry biomass resources, huge quantity and diverse varieties. Under the background of favorable policies, the utilization of biomass resources has achieved considerable development in China, but at the same time, many problems in technology and equipment have arisen.
